Image forming method and system |
(57) A photosensitive material containing a photosensitive silver halide and an organic
silver salt and capable of forming an image, which corresponds to a latent image recorded
on the photosensitive material through exposure, when the photosensitive material
is heated, is utilized for forming an image. The photosensitive material, on which
the latent image has been recorded, is heated, and the image corresponding to the
latent image is formed with the heating on the photosensitive material. The image
is read out from the heat-developed photosensitive material, and an image signal having
thus been obtained is subjected to image processing for forming a digital image signal,
from which the image is capable of being reproduced.
